White Castle Hamburger Recipe

A homemade version of the classic White Castle hamburger.

Preparation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 10 minutes
Total Time: 25 minutes
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: American
Servings: 4 servings
Calories: 300 kcal

Ingredients 

Main Ingredients

  • 1 lb Ground beef
  • 1 packet Dry onion soup mix
  • ½ cup Water
  • 8 slices American cheese
  • 8 pieces Slider buns
  • 1 cup Finely chopped onions
  • to taste Pickles

Instructions 

  1. 1. Mix ground beef, dry onion soup mix, and water in a bowl.
  2. 2. Spread the mixture evenly on a griddle and cook over medium heat.
  3. 3. Once the beef is cooked, cut it into small squares to fit the slider buns.
  4. 4. Place a slice of cheese on each beef square and let it melt.
  5. 5. Place the beef and cheese squares on slider buns, add chopped onions and pickles.
  6. 6. Serve immediately and enjoy!
